The RHEEM 61-102498-15 is a reversing valve designed for heat pump systems, where it controls the direction of refrigerant flow to switch the unit between heating and cooling modes. This component is a core element of the refrigerant circuit, redirecting flow from the compressor to either the indoor or outdoor coil depending on the operating mode. Licensed HVAC technicians handle installation and replacement of this valve as part of heat pump service and repair work.
This reversing valve is intended for use in heat pump applications where the system must alternate between heating and cooling cycles. It is typically found in residential and light commercial heat pump equipment. When the solenoid coil is energized or de-energized, the valve slides to redirect refrigerant flow accordingly, making it a critical component for proper system operation throughout both seasons.

Reversing valve replacement is a refrigerant-circuit procedure that must be performed by an EPA Section 608 certified HVAC technician. Recover all refrigerant from the system before opening the refrigerant circuit. The valve is brazed into the refrigerant lines, requiring proper torch work and nitrogen purging during installation to prevent oxidation inside the tubing. Always verify correct solenoid coil wiring and system operation in both heating and cooling modes after completing the repair.
